Around the same time, Virgin & Rumour started
the post punk psychadelic group Sekret Sekret in which they achieved 5 No1
positions in the Australian Independent charts. Sekret Sekret lasted 7 years
and were the major influence for such bands as the Triffids, The Go - Betweens
and the Church. You can find their song ' New King Jack' on Tim Pittmans'
"Tales Of The Australian Underground" double album. |

When Sekret Sekret formally ended Dan Rumour, Ken Gormley and Jim Elliot created the Cruel Sea adding Tex Perkins on vocals. The Cruel Sea became Australias biggest band with many hits and awards. David Virgin went to Dublin in the late '80s to play folk music and produce Dublin artists. On returning to Australia he recorded Landlord Green with Dan Rumour. David returned to Europe and spent seven years recording and gigging extensively based in the south of France, Amsterdam and Dublin. |

| David has now recorded his 2nd
album with Dan Rumour, the first was "Landlord Green" released
in 1992. The latest release titled "VIRGIN & RUMOUR" recorded Winter 2004 is a special coming together for these two elder statesmen of Australian Underground Music. |
